2014 Canadian National Championships

Day Three Finals

The second last night of competition began with the 400m Free for the team Pacific Coast.

Molly Gowans came back from a struggle in prelim's to look a little more healthy tonight and put together a great race. The race split at 200m and Gowans went at the early B Final leader chasing her down the final 50 and finishing just behind Saroukian of Edmonton. Despite being the youngest in the 20 spots Gowans final 50 was 3rd fastest overall and gave testimony to her discipline in training and racing. Her time of 4:22.0 left her 12th overall moving up one spot.

Jon McKay also raced in the 400m Free B Final in the men's race. Mckay stayed with the mid pack and gave a great effort finishing in 4:03 for 16th place.

The 200m Backstroke dawned a bit earlier than Lauren Crisp was ready for. While her start was solid she was out a shade behind the race on the first 50 and climbed through the field over the following 100m then turned it on coming home. Interestingly Crisp was also the youngest in the field of 20 and her final 50 ranked 5th fastest of all the second swims. Her 2:21 final time was good enough for 16th place.

The team is currently in 12th place on the women's side and 31st overall and currently 3rd top BC Team.

The final day of competition begins tomorrow at 9:00 PST.
